japanese style pasta  Smile Mar 25,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Japanese | Restaurant | Pasta

personally i am not into fusion food cause i normally find them tasted weird but the display of this restaurant looked not bad so decided to give it a shot. i ordered the hokkaido cream soup spagetti to try and it looked quite nice when it was served. i think the taste was something like carbonara but then less creamy which reminded me of the cream udon that i like from waraku. the portion of spagetti was also quite generous for just regular size and i think is value for money

 

 

 
 
Spending per head: Approximately $16(Dinner)

dinner Smile Mar 25,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Japanese | Restaurant | Sushi/Sashimi

went down with friends for dinner last week but i was a little skeptical about this restaurant due to the horrible service that i had at the other outlet. my friend made a reservation so we did not have to wait to be seated. i ordered the chirashi set with extra inari sushi. i think the sushi was very average but the set had really generous portion of food. the chirashi don was quite different from what i eat normally but i quite like the choice of sashimi. tempura was average, quite crispy and the teriyaki chicken was a little too sweet. as usual, i like the chawamushi and the cha soba was quite nice too

 

 
 
Spending per head: Approximately $22(Dinner)

chicken cheese set OK Mar 25,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Japanese | Sushi/Sashimi

went down to ichiban sushi for lunch couple of weeks ago and ordered the chicken cheese set since it looked so nice on the menu. we went down for lunch about 12 and there was quite alot of people in the store but not full house yet. but i think the service was really bad and it was due to severely under staff. i saw the whole store only have about 3 staff and they were busy running around. and we had to wait very long for our food to be ordered and even longer time for the food to arrive. so i was very disappointed with the service.
bad serive aside, the food was not too bad. i ordered my favourite tobiko sushi, it tasted not too bad, the roe was quite crunchy. the set meals portion were really huge, normally it came with a main dish, rice, side dish, chawamushi and fruits. that day the soft shell crab tasted quite horrible and was not hot. the chicken was quite nice but too salty. so my favourite dish from the set was the chawamushi

 

 
 
Spending per head: Approximately $20(Lunch)

takoyaki Smile Mar 25,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Japanese | Stall / Kiosk | Desserts and Cakes

it has been a long time since i last ate takoyaki so gotten a few pieces to try. i gotten the original takoyaki sauce, since i too long never ate at gindaco i forgotten the staff put such generous portion of mayo on top on the takoyaki so i had to scrapped away the sauce before i ate. i think the nice thing about gindaco takoyaki is the slightly crispy skin that most other takoyaki store does not have

 
 
Spending per head: Approximately $3(Other)

claypot hor fun OK Mar 25,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Singaporean | Stall / Kiosk | Porridge/Congee | Kids-Friendly

ordered the seafood claypot hor fun to try since my friend recommended me this chain as the other outlet he tried was really nice. i think the presentation of the hor fun looks not bad, quite nice but the taste was slightly blend but if eaten with the green chili, i think was not bad. the portion was average, quite ok for a girl but may be not enough for the guys. i think the concept of putting the noodle in a claypot instead of the normal metal mini wok is quite new and keep the food warm much better

 
 
Spending per head: Approximately $5(Lunch)
